Quality Luggage and Travel Bags

Reliable luggage represents the foundation of comfortable travel. Gift ideas for travelers focusing on quality bags demonstrate understanding of their constant journey needs.

Durable Travel Backpacks

Versatile travel backpacks from backpack collections serve as carry-on luggage, day packs, and personal item bags. Look for 40-50 liter capacity designs meeting most airline carry-on restrictions while providing adequate space for extended trips. Premium travel packs ($150-$300) feature lockable zippers, hidden pockets deterring pickpockets, and suspension systems ensuring comfort during long airport walks.

Quality travel backpacks include laptop compartments protecting electronics, compression straps reducing bulk, and weather-resistant materials protecting contents from unexpected rain. Convertible designs with hideaway straps allow using backpacks in professional settings without obvious outdoor appearance.

Travel Duffels and Weekender Bags

Durable duffel bags from duffel collections provide flexible packing for various trip types. Soft-sided construction allows squeezing bags into tight overhead compartments while maintaining generous capacity. Look for designs with multiple carrying options including backpack straps, shoulder straps, and handles accommodating different transportation scenarios.

Premium duffels ($100-$250) feature waterproof materials, reinforced stress points preventing strap failures, and organizational compartments separating clean from dirty clothing. Some innovative designs include removable daypacks or shoe compartments maintaining organization during trips.

Luggage Accessories and Organization

Packing cubes and compression bags ($20-$60 for sets) revolutionize luggage organization. These simple tools separate clothing categories, compress soft items saving space, and streamline packing and unpacking processes. Gift complete organization systems including various sized cubes, laundry bags, and toiletry organizers creating comprehensive packing solutions.

Luggage tags, TSA-approved locks, and luggage scales ($15-$40 combined) represent practical accessories preventing common travel frustrations. Digital luggage scales help avoiding overweight baggage fees while quality locks protect belongings during checked baggage handling.

Travel Comfort and Convenience Items

Enhancing travel comfort transforms exhausting journeys into pleasant experiences. These thoughtful gifts show attention to traveler wellbeing during long flights, drives, or train rides.

Travel Pillows and Sleep Accessories

Quality travel pillows from pillow collections dramatically improve rest during transit. Modern designs support necks properly preventing the painful stiffness traditional horseshoe pillows cause. Memory foam or inflatable options pack compactly while providing substantial comfort. Premium travel pillows ($30-$60) include washable covers, adjustable firmness, and versatile shapes supporting various sleeping positions.

Complement pillows with silk or microfiber sleep masks blocking light completely, and noise-canceling earplugs or headphones creating peaceful environments despite surrounding chaos. Complete sleep kits ($60-$150) ensure quality rest regardless of travel conditions.

Portable Comfort Items

Packable blankets and travel throws provide warmth during cold flights or train journeys. Compact designs from travel accessories fold into integrated stuff sacks occupying minimal luggage space. Look for materials combining warmth with moisture-wicking properties handling various climate conditions.

Compression socks ($15-$30) improve circulation during long flights preventing swelling and reducing blood clot risks. These medical-grade accessories make thoughtful gifts for frequent flyers or travelers with circulation concerns.

Tech Accessories for Modern Travelers

Technology integration dominates modern travel. Tech-focused gifts enable seamless connectivity while protecting valuable devices during journeys.

Universal Power Adapters and Chargers

Universal travel adapters ($25-$50) with multiple plug configurations work worldwide eliminating country-specific adapter collections. Premium models include USB ports and USB-C outputs charging multiple devices simultaneously without occupying multiple wall outlets. Some advanced versions incorporate surge protection and voltage conversion protecting sensitive electronics.

Multi-port USB chargers ($30-$80) consolidate charging needs allowing simultaneous device charging from single outlets. Compact designs minimize luggage space while providing adequate power for phones, tablets, cameras, and other travel essentials. Consider models with fast-charging capabilities reducing charging time during brief hotel stays.

Portable Battery Banks and Solar Chargers

High-capacity portable batteries (20,000+ mAh) keep devices powered during long travel days without outlet access. Quality power banks ($40-$100) include multiple output ports, fast-charging technology, and rugged construction withstanding travel abuse. Some models feature integrated cables eliminating separate cord carrying.

Solar panel chargers ($60-$150) suit adventure travelers spending extended periods outdoors. Foldable designs from portable power collections pack flat while providing substantial charging capability during sunny conditions. These prove particularly valuable for travelers combining wilderness exploration with urban adventures.

Cable Organizers and Tech Protection

Electronic organizers ($15-$40) prevent the tangled cable chaos plaguing most travelers. Padded cases with elastic loops, pockets, and compartments organize chargers, adapters, cables, and small electronics systematically. Water-resistant materials protect contents from spills or weather exposure.

Portable hard drives or high-capacity memory cards ($40-$150) enable backing up travel photos preventing devastating loss of irreplaceable memories. Consider pairing storage with photo editing software subscriptions or digital photo frame gifts allowing easy sharing and displaying of travel adventures.

Travel Clothing and Accessories

Specialized travel clothing enhances comfort while reducing luggage bulk. These functional gifts demonstrate understanding of practical travel needs.

Quick-Dry Technical Apparel

Travel-specific clothing from clothing collections features wrinkle-resistant fabrics, quick-dry properties, and odor-resistant treatments allowing extended wear between washings. Technical shirts, pants, and underwear reduce packing requirements while maintaining fresh appearance throughout trips.

Quality travel clothing sets including multiple shirts, pants, and underwear ($150-$300) create complete wardrobe systems. Versatile neutral colors allow mixing and matching while maintaining appropriate appearance across various settings from hiking trails to restaurant dining.

Weather Protection and Layering

Packable rain jackets from jacket collections provide essential weather protection without consuming excessive luggage space. Modern designs compress into integrated stuff sacks becoming barely noticeable until weather turns bad. Look for breathable waterproof fabrics preventing interior moisture buildup during active use.

Lightweight down or synthetic insulated jackets offer warmth during unexpected cold snaps or over-air-conditioned transportation. Premium packable jackets ($100-$250) provide substantial insulation while compressing to softball sizes fitting easily in personal item bags.

Versatile Accessories

Multi-purpose accessories maximize travel utility. Convertible scarves doubling as blankets, pillow covers, or fashion accessories from accessories collections provide versatile solutions. Packable hats from hat collections protect from sun while maintaining crushable designs surviving luggage compression.

Quality travel belts ($30-$60) with hidden zip pockets secure cash and documents discretely. These security-focused accessories provide peace of mind in crowded tourist areas or during overnight transportation.

Hydration and Personal Care

Staying hydrated and maintaining hygiene during travel prevents common discomforts. These practical gifts address essential travel health needs.

Reusable Water Bottles and Filtration

Insulated water bottles from bottle collections maintain beverage temperatures for 12-24 hours while providing leak-proof hydration during flights and ground transportation. Collapsible bottles save space when empty making them ideal for travelers prioritizing luggage efficiency.

Water filtration bottles ($30-$60) enable safe drinking from questionable sources worldwide. Built-in filters remove bacteria and protozoa providing peace of mind when bottled water isn't available or trusted. These prove particularly valuable for adventure travelers or those visiting developing regions.

Toiletry Kits and Personal Care

Complete toiletry kits ($25-$60) with TSA-compliant containers simplify liquid restrictions while organizing personal care products. Hanging designs allow accessing contents without unpacking entire kits particularly valuable during brief hotel stays or hostel accommodation.

Quick-dry towels from travel gear pack compactly while absorbing effectively and drying rapidly. Microfiber construction provides functionality in spaces roughly one-quarter traditional towel sizes. These prove essential for travelers visiting beaches, pools, or accommodations without provided linens.

Navigation and Documentation Tools

Organized travel documentation and reliable navigation prevent common travel frustrations. These gifts combine practicality with traveler-specific utility.

Travel Wallets and Document Organizers

RFID-blocking travel wallets from wallet collections protect credit cards and passports from electronic theft while organizing essential documents. Designs with multiple compartments, currency pockets, and card slots consolidate travel documents preventing the scattered chaos causing airport stress.

Premium travel organizers ($40-$100) include passport holders, boarding pass pockets, pen loops, and zippered compartments securing everything from SIM cards to memory cards. Leather or durable synthetic materials withstand years of frequent travel while maintaining professional appearance.

Portable Luggage Tracking Devices

GPS luggage trackers ($25-$50 plus subscriptions) attach to bags enabling location monitoring through smartphone apps. These provide peace of mind during checked baggage handling or when storing bags in hostels or hotels. Some advanced models send alerts if bags move unexpectedly or exit predefined geographic areas.

Digital luggage tags with e-ink displays ($50-$80) allow updating contact information digitally without replacing physical tags. Battery-powered displays maintain information for months while international travelers appreciate updating details without purchasing new tags each destination.
